Those weighing alternatives should consider size and specialty. For loved ones requiring very high-acuity medical support, complex memory care with a formal dementia unit, or hospital-style staffing on every shift, larger facilities or specialized centers may deliver resources that a small ALF cannot replicate. If a family expressly needs rigid clinical programming, expansive on-site rehab services, or standardized, institution-like routines, it is reasonable to explore options beyond this intimate home setting. The same logic applies if proximity to certain specialists or specific insurance networks is a decisive factor; a bigger campus may offer broader convenience.

Prospective residents should test a few practical considerations during visits. Inquire about staffing ratios on different shifts, how staff transitions are managed, and how physicians and specialists integrate into daily care. Observe interactions during mealtimes and activities, are staff patient, respectful, and genuinely present? Ask to see a resident’s routine, how personal care is delivered, and what enrichment options are available, from hair appointments to social events. Clarify room configurations, visitation policies, and transportation arrangements, ensuring alignment with expectations around privacy, noise levels, and daily rhythms.
